Transaction 08919297089b9646a933281b68ce590f6f655fa093d52016d7cadcd19cac24ed
1 Input
1 Output
-
08919297089b9646a933281b68ce590f6f655fa093d52016d7cadcd19cac24ed:0
- value
- 1290482
- script pubkey
- OP_0 OP_PUSHBYTES_20 fecfef481774f43a90250e7284f192de7335fa05
- address
- bc1qlm877jqhwn6r4yp9peegfuvjmeent7s9659jk9